Spanish

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): (Spain) /aˈθeɾa/ [aˈθe.ɾa]
  • IPA(key): (Latin America) /aˈseɾa/ [aˈse.ɾa]
  • Rhymes: -eɾa
  • Syllabification: a‧ce‧ra

Etymology 1

From hacera, from facera, from facero, from Latin faciarius, from faciēs (face).

Noun

acera f (plural aceras)

  1. pavement, sidewalk
    Synonyms: (Guatemala, Mexico, Philippines) banqueta, (Latin America) vereda
